* feat: add python client context to ai chat system prompt
Add PYTHON_WINDMILL_CLIENT_CONTEXT with function signatures and descriptions for key windmill client functions in Python, including:
- Resource operations (get_resource, set_resource)
- State management (get_state, set_state, get_flow_user_state, set_flow_user_state)
- Variables (get_variable, set_variable)
- Script execution (run_script, run_script_async, wait_job)
- S3 file operations (load_s3_file, write_s3_file)
- Flow operations (run_flow_async, get_resume_urls)
- Utilities (whoami, get_job_status, set_progress)
The context is now included for Python language (python3) in the AI chat system prompt, providing users with helpful function signatures and descriptions when asking for coding assistance.

* fix: correct $props generic syntax in Svelte 5 components
Replace incorrect `$props<T>()` syntax with correct `let x: T = $props()` syntax
to ensure proper TypeScript typing instead of falling back to `any` types.
This affects 11 Svelte 5 components throughout the frontend codebase.
